The Electoral Public Prosecutor's Office requests the rejection of Damares' accounts and the return of funds to the Treasury.

The agency points to irregularities in the campaign of Bolsonaro's former minister who was elected senator.

247 The Electoral Public Prosecutor's Office has pointed out irregularities in the campaign finance report submitted by former minister Damares Alves, who was elected senator for the Republicanos party in the Federal District. 

The Attorney General's opinion recommends the disapproval of Damares' accounts and the return of the funds to the National Treasury.

According to the Public Prosecutor's Office, the documentation for approximately R$ 595 is in an "irregular" situation. The balance includes expenses for the production of electoral propaganda, campaign services, fuel, and private security – a category not included in the list of expenses with public funds, it reports. UOL report.

Of the total, R$ 105 refers to expenses paid with the Party Fund and R$ 489 with the Electoral Fund.
